Today’s Marathi romantic fiction breaks away from traditional taboos. Contemporary authors write about long-distance relationships, corporate life, live-in arrangements, and the complexities of finding love in a digital age. The emotional core remains uniquely Maharashtrian—characterized by understated elegance, witty banter, and deep emotional resilience—but the conflicts are thoroughly modern. 3.
